In 2022, Mercosur achieved historic volumes of beef exports, a total of 3.4 million tons, 16.4% above 2021. Of the 4 countries, 3 reached new ceilings: Brazil, Argentina and Paraguay, while the Shipments from Uruguay were slightly lower than the previous year. This was revealed by a report by the Mediterranean Foundation, cited by the Argentine media outlet Los Andes, which revealed that the bloc's beef exports were a record last year. The 3.36 million tons also rose 69% compared to 5 years ago. In 2022, shipments closed at 2 million tons for Brazil, while there were 630,000 tons from Argentina, 396,000 tons from Uruguay, and 334,000 tons from Paraguay, according to the latest report from the consultant.
